False Ceiling
Third Year B.Arch. 2007-08 Mrs. A.V.Dixit
We provide a False Ceiling for:
1.To hide the uneven structural grid and give a smooth finished ceiling.
2.To reduce volume of a room for increased efficiency of AC.
3.To hide the light source.
4.For acoustical treatment.
5.To hide electrical & air conditioning ductwork.
6.For pleasing aesthetics.

Materials for false ceilings:
•metal ceiling
•aluminium panel ceiling
•gypsum board ceiling
•plaster tile,
•vinyl laminated gypsum tile
•mineral fibre acoustic ceiling;
• Calcium Silicate board
PVC ceiling.
Cork
Wooden Boards
Thermocol
Now a days fiber glass is used on large scale for appearance and other purposes like artificial sky of a planetarium which is fixed directly with main structure with the help of some special carbohydrate gum materials.

Aluminium Ceiling Tile
Thickness: 9mm, 9.5mm, 12mm, 12.5mm. Size: 1220x2440mm or 1220x3000mm
Mineral Fibre Acoustic Ceiling Tile;
Fire resistance class A,
good acoustic effect,
thickness 10mm, 12mm, 15mm.
Size: 2'x2' and 2'x4'.
Suspension: square edge or tegular also available.
Calcium Silicate board
100% asbestos-free,
thickness range 5mm-15mm. Fireproof class A.

False Ceiling :
In the case of frame work of false ceiling, must be sufficient strong to take its own load plus the load of one or two workers to work on it.
For designing the frame work, it is necessary to consider the dead weight of all the materials of false ceiling and the span of space.
First the frame work is done.
Generally this is done by the help of steel or wooden members depending on the span and the cost.
The construction of frame for false ceiling also depends on the
site conditions,
materials available,
requirements,
cost and
other support members available along with main structural members.
In the case of a picture hall or auditorium, generally roofs are supported on steel trusses.
To make a frame for false ceiling therefore first frame work is done with the help of steel members then wooden members are fixed with these steel members to divide the larger area into smaller areas of required size governing the size of materials.
Wall lining and false ceiling play an important role in the field of interior decoration.
By this operation we get another light Weight-decorative surface over the structural surface to protect from the weather reaction and sound pollution.

1.To conceal the constructional defects.
2 . To provide better appearance.
3. To provide heat insulation lo reduce the load on air- conditioning unit.
4. To improve acoustics of internal space.
5. To reduce the reflection of light from the various surfaces.
6. To conceal the direct lighting instruments to get defuse light.
7. To provide a comfortable environment.

Toilet Partitions
Aluminum partitions find their applications in office buildings to make group or cellular workplaces.
Made of high grade aluminum, aluminum partitions are
versatile,
non-load bearing
& relocatable,
just perfect for internal use.
These can be custom availed as per specific height and length of client requirements.
Rust proof • Resistant to corrosion• Light in weight • High tensile strength ensures less deformity • No thermal stresses due to variation in temperature
Doors and partitions of almost any size and type can be fabricated using aluminium extrusions. Door frames are available in a wide range of sizes. Shutter verticals, shutter top and bottom styles are available . Intermediate transoms are used to reduce loss due to breakage of glass
